My first impression is that it looks very cool, and it's very light and comfortable, but the clasp is a huge pain to take on and off. I'm starting to get better at it now, but it's super awkward. Like the first time I tried to take it off and put it on, it took me a good 15 minutes to do both.
The stock bracelet has the advantage of having a clasp that's easy to use, but the micro-adjustment "notch" bothers me a lot. They're both very comfortable to wear, and overall both look great, but the clasp on the Komfit is really awkward, and takes quite a bit of practice to be able to take it on and off quickly. In terms of look though, it's really just down to personal preference. Both are very comfortable to wear, and both look very good in their own way. They're also both historically accurate, in that the stock bracelet is a steel recreation of the gold bracelets on the BA 145.022 Speedies given to Astronauts and Nixon as gifts, and the Komfit is a reproduction of the bracelets that they wore to the moon. So, on balance, they're both good bracelets, but both have their weaknesses, and it really depends on what's important to you, but you can't really go far wrong with either of them.
